Hello out there I just received ten axolots. I was thinking about keeping some in my pond. Would they winter over alright outside.

As long as the pond doesn't freeze solid, and if it DOES freeze over, not too thick, they should be fine. This question has been asked before, so do a forum search and see what other information you can find.
